Tale of two toons

Here is a summary of two different gnomes who have spent the last two weeks living inside the random dungeon finder.

Mudge (lvl80 mage):
This fellow managed to level without ever once pugging.In fact he had never run an instance with a full 5 man compliment before the LFD.As a result he is used to casual runs with a couple guild mates.There was always time to enjoy the scenery,loot or just generally mess around.Crowd control and planning were actually part of his repertoire.
Needless to say, the random runs he gets now are a bit of a culture shock.He is thrust into heroics he has never seen before and caught up in the mad dash to the end.Everyone is in a hurry and the slow or weak are left behind to die.It is sometimes rather intimidating to find yourself among the worst geared in the group on top of being totally clueless about where you are going or what is expected of you.But you know what, it has actually made me a better player.The relentless pace has forced me to manage my mana on a level never required before.My situational awareness and threat management are being perfected.I find myself adapting to the various boss mechanics and widely differing group dynamics faster every run.It is a trial by fire and so far he seems to be holding his own.
There are a lot of people complaining about this new system allowing failplayers to be carried and gear up in epics they never earned.I have yet to experience it.Any complete noob that doesn't bother trying is quickly left behind.The fucktards that sometimes grace our presence are vote kicked so fast it will make your head spin.These groups are after one thing only.They want their emblems as fast as possible.They have zero tolerance for the lazy or stupid.
It is natural selection at it's finest.

Wizzlesnot (lvl33 rogue):
This little guy is living the dream.He is dripping in heirloom gear and has a cartel of 80s funding his habits.Thanks to the LFD he no longer even needs to quest.He has fully embraced the mercenary lifestyle and has so far gained over 7 levels with it.His typical day is spent relaxing in Ironforge with a beer in one hand and a fishing pole in the other.Every so often the call will go out and he will find himself ported to the entrance of some random dungeon.He will quietly and efficiently kill everything in his path and when the final boss drops he gets paid and then leaves without a word.
Wizzlesnot - Hired Gun , Pest Removal Expert , Facilitator of Smooth Runs
